Live Bar Jan. 6 The Rockets beat the Wizards 114-111 on the road today.

The Rockets brought Christian Wood and Kevin Potter Jr. back from one of their suspensions, and Rockets head coach Silas said he had to hold his players accountable but still believed in them and still loved them. After Wood and Porter returned to the training ground, he also said on Tuesday, "Nothing could be better than being on the pitch." ”

From Wood's outburst, getting seven of the Rockets' first nine points (Porter scored another 2), to Potter's winning three-pointer in the final second, nothing could have left the Rockets behind their previous events. Silas said: "I told them in the dressing room that I was proud of them for these players who fought back in place. Obviously, we gave them a lot of support, but they all showed it. ”
